Erlang upnp mediaserver
Failed to load latest commit information.
doc init Sep 20, 2010
docroot init Sep 20, 2010
erlmediaserver init Sep 20, 2010
images init Sep 20, 2010
include init Sep 20, 2010
priv init Sep 20, 2010
radiodb init Sep 20, 2010
src changed os_info in that way that i can now handle unix and mac systems Sep 21, 2010
testdir/a init Sep 20, 2010
Emakefile init Sep 20, 2010
Makefile changed Sep 20, 2010
README add NOTE for the problem with the os Sep 20, 2010


Required software

To use the erlmediaserver you have to install yaws in your enviroment. In the Makefile there is the path to the yaws installation included.

How does things work together

After starting the erlmediaserver, a yaws webserver will be avaiable under the current ip address on port 5001. 
Also ssdp is started. This is the server which send the alive message via multicast 1900. The ssdp will also receive messages from upnp client on this port. 

When the server is started and you know the ip you can enter the URL http://<IP>:5001/description/fetch and you will see the description of the server

NOTE: The server only works on MAC OS, because i used sw_vers to detect the OS infos. I will fix this immediately!!!